I have just a couple "reviews", and I wouldn't consider them recommendations (more like warnings?).
First of all, I should explain that recently I was in Vegas for only one day, and chose a non-iDine for lunch, and so was only looking for one iDine for dinner, and wanted it to be not too far from my North Las Vegas hotel (nowhere near The Strip), and was looking for something vegetarian. I made note of two chain restaurants (both of which have locations in the iDine listings all over the Vegas area).
First I tried Better Nutrition/Kristen's Lo Carb Kafe. Before I go on, I need to explain something that iDine doesn't explain well: Better Nutrition locations that don't have Kristen's Lo Carb Kafe (only 4 do) are simply nutrition supplement/etc stores, not restaurants! (This makes it a very unusual category for iDine, so unusual that they misclassify them as vegetarian restaurants.) But the one I went to on Craig Rd did have the Kafe. I was able to walk in and look at it, and it look like an ultracheapo fast food/diner counter (in one corner of what was otherwise a store). But it mattered little anyhow, because it was 7:25 pm and they told me they'd closed half an hour before! So that was out before it started.
So I went to an Acapulco Grill, which is a local Mexican food chain. It had the look of an ultracheapo pizza joint except it was Mexican food. The food was acceptable but nothing to write home about.
I don't think I'd go back to either of those chains.
